Tips On Handling The Wedding Gift Table

| Total Words: 396

When youre planning a wedding, you dont want to forget the gift table. Not only will this be covered with your presents and money gifts, but it will also be out in the open. And although you dont want to think that anything could happen, you might want to put a few precautions in place.

Better to be safe

The gift table is best kept safe by being out in the open, where everyone can see it. You might want the deejay next to it, or at least nearby, because people will be going up that way all evening.

However, you also want to keep the gift table somewhere where your guests can find it to deposit their gifts or cards. A nice slit top box works well for cards (maybe you could put a locked tin inside so that no one can peek except you) and a card table with a table cloth is fine for the wrapped gifts.

You may also want to have the guest registry next to the gift table so that you have an idea of how many presents should be there when you finally get to opening them. If there seems to be a discrepancy, then you will be able to find out if something was lost or stolen.
